Europe de facto in state of war, says Serbian president

According to Aleksandar Vucic, the West has intensified its pressure on Serbia after the beginning of the conflict in Ukraine

BELGRADE, January 23. /TASS/. Europe is, in fact, in a state of war, no matter what politicians on the continent may say, Serbian President Aleksandar Vucic said on Monday.

"Europe is de facto in a state of war, whatever they may say. There is no more tolerance <…>. And they want their backyard - and the Western Balkans, and, naturally, Serbia are their backyard, and they want to have things the way they want them here," he said in an address to the nation.

According to the Serbian leader, the West has intensified its pressure on Serbia after the beginning of the conflict in Ukraine.

Vucic said earlier that the conflict in Ukraine is a world war where the West is fighting against Russia by means of Ukrainian soldiers. He noted that the situation in Ukraine is impacting the Balkans and vowed that Serbia will spare no effort to preserve peace in the region.
